In Surely You're Joking Mr Feynman, Richard P. Feynman shares his extraordinary life experiences through a series of captivating anecdotes and conversations with his friend Ralph Leighton. This intriguing book takes readers on a journey through various episodes of Feynman's life, from his early childhood in Far Rockaway, New York, to his critical role in the Manhattan Project during World War II, and his eventual recognition as one of the world's most brilliant theoretical physicists. Along the way, Feynman's insatiable curiosity and irreverent sense of humour shine through, offering an inspiring glimpse into the mind of this exceptional scientist.

With a new introduction by Bill Gates, this intriguing memoir not only showcases Feynman's scientific prowess but also his insatiable curiosity about the world and his penchant for pranks and adventure. Feynman's knack for exploring the unconventional is evident in his escapades, ranging from playing the bongos to participating in safecracking challenges. His unique perspective on life and science offers an engaging narrative that entertains as much as it enlightens.

Richard Feynman, the recipient of the Nobel Prize for Physics in 1965, emerges as a multifaceted character in this book. He was more than just a theoretical physicist; he was an artist, a practical joker, and an exceptional storyteller. Feynman's dialogues with Ralph Leighton, which were recorded over several years, have been preserved in their candid, conversational form. This allows readers to experience Feynman's wisdom, humour, and relentless pursuit of knowledge as though they were part of his inner circle.

The result is a wise, funny, passionate, and utterly honest self-portrait of one of the 20th century's most remarkable individuals. About the Author

Richard P Feynman (Author) Richard Feynman was, until his death in 1988, the most famous physicist in the world. Only an infinitesimal part of the general population could understand his mathematical physics, but his outgoing and sunny personality, his gift for exposition, his habit of playing the bongo drums, and his testimony to the Presidential Commission on the Challenger Space Shuttle disaster turned him into a celebrity. Freeman Dyson, of the Institute for Advanced Study in Princeton, New Jersey, called him 'the most original mind of his generation', while in its obituary The New York Times described him as 'arguably the most brilliant, iconoclastic and influential of the postwar generation of theoretical physicists'.
